Rollup merge of #142597 - folkertdev:abi-cannot-be-called, r=workingjubilee
error on calls to ABIs that cannot be called We recently added `extern "custom"`, which cannot be called using a rust call expression. But there are more ABIs that can't be called in that way, because the call does not semantically make sense.
